Courses from 1000+ universities
Seven years after replacing a Yale president with a fintech CEO, Coursera picks an Amazon veteran to help fix its slowing growth and falling stock price.
600 Free Google Certifications
Data Analysis
Project Management
Graphic Design
Critical Perspectives on Management
Design Patterns
Supporting Victims of Domestic Violence
Organize and share your learning with Class Central Lists.
View our Lists Showcase
Learn API Design, earn certificates with free online courses from Udemy, Coursera, freeCodeCamp, LinkedIn Learning and other top learning platforms around the world. Read reviews to decide if a class is right for you.
Develop Event Driven Microservices using Spring Boot, Axon framework, CQRS, Saga, Event Sourcing patterns
Learn system design, technology selection etc from Accenture, Infosys etc to become a successful solutions architect
Master .NET backend development: ASP.NET Core architecture, MVC patterns, and RESTful Web API design. Build scalable, secure web applications and APIs using modern ASP.NET tools and best practices.
Learn to design, build, and secure APIs using Google Cloud's Apigee platform. Gain hands-on experience through real-world scenarios and develop your first set of APIs in a free environment.
Master database management fundamentals and build secure RESTful APIs, covering SQL, NoSQL with MongoDB, and API integration using Express.js for modern web applications.
Master Java web services development with Spring Boot, building robust SOAP and REST APIs while learning essential frameworks, database integration, and security implementation for production-ready applications.
Comprehensive Python API development using FastAPI, covering database integration, authentication, testing, deployment, and CI/CD pipelines. Build a production-ready API from scratch.
Learn the basics of REST APIs. Discover what they are, why they matter, and how putting REST APIs to use can help you build faster, more efficient applications.
Learn how to write API documentation that’s clear, concise, approachable, and easy for consumers to use.
In this course, we will be covering how to build a modern, greenfield serverless backend on AWS.
Learn how to build and document high-quality APIs with Swagger and the OpenAPI Specification.
Discover how to build robust web APIs with ASP.NET Core, the open-source framework for Windows, macOS, and Linux.
Data is the currency of modern business, and APIs are the means for unlocking data's value. However, designing and constructing APIs can be a daunting task. In this course, REST Fundamentals, you'll learn how to design and implement systems that follow…
Learn how to develop APIs using Swagger tooling and the OpenAPI specification.
Being able to design simple and fluent API to make your business applications easier to read is what you will get by following this course. All the tools brought by Java 8 to implement the standard Design Patterns are covered with many live demos.
Get personalized course recommendations, track subjects and courses with reminders, and more.